Cardinals Organizational Summary:
The Arizona Cardinals Football Club is a professional football team within the National Football League (NFL). We compete in the National Football Conference (NFC) West division and call State Farm Stadium, in Glendale, Arizona, our home.
As one of the oldest pro football franchises in the U.S., the Club has established itself as a sport and cultural hallmark within Arizona, as well as a trailblazer for diversity, equity, inclusion, and belonging (DEIB) initiatives and firsts around the League. Job Summary:
The Creative Project Manager will manage the development of projects through the Creative team from inception through production, tracking the stage and location of each project and delivering final presentations and/or production-ready files, ensuring projects are completed on time and within budget.
Primary Job Duties:
The Creative Project Manager will have the daily responsibilities including, without limitation, to the following:
Manage all projects briefed into the Creative team from initiation through completion.
Coordinate and maintain production schedules with internal teams, external designers, and vendors.
Develop project timelines and lead project kick-off and weekly status meetings with key stakeholders.
Oversee production efforts across a range of partners, including external brand agencies and the in-house creative team.
Gather and define project requirements to ensure clarity of scope and deliverables.
Lead campaign production and delivery of final toolkits for initiatives such as Draft, Kickoff Week, Playoffs, and other Arizona Cardinals brand programs.
Identify opportunities to improve design and production workflows, promoting efficiency and consistency across projects.
Analyze cost estimates, negotiate with vendors, and drive cost-effective solutions.
Maintain a deep understanding of design direction and brand guidelines for both the Arizona Cardinals and State Farm Stadium.
Source, recommend, and assign production vendors based on project needs.
Ensure all projects are delivered on time, on scope, and within budget.
